Position Summary

The Sr. Field Technician will inspect, test, and maintain high, medium, and low electrical power equipment. Technicians will work with electrical equipment such as SF6 & vacuum circuit breakers, pad mount transformers/GSU transformers, grounding, instrument transformers, and variances of switches both manual and motor operated. Technicians will implement safety policies.

Responsibilities
  • Drive daily locally/regionally and be available for periodic overnight travel
  • Lead safety briefings on job sites, identify, eliminate, or mitigate hazards
  • Perform high, medium, and low voltage testing of electrical power equipment as a crew leader
  • Utilize Human Performance Error Elimination concepts and tools
  • Consult manuals, schematics, wiring diagrams, and engineering personnel in order to troubleshoot and solve equipment problems and determine optimum equipment functioning
  • Prepare and maintain reports detailing all tests, repairs, and maintenance performed
  • Troubleshoot, repair, replace, and clean equipment and components
  • Lead safety culture and be responsible for other team members
  • Install, test, and maintain electrical apparatus
  • Understand the theory behind and reason for testing with the ability to analyze results
  • Develop and write reports
  • Create plans for testing apparatus
  • Project manage large scale and complex projects
  • Train and qualify Field Technician I, II, and III
  • Interact with customers
  • Perform complex troubleshooting
